The Cloud Security Alliance (CSA) has published a document that provides an in-depth analysis of the main cloud computing threats. ‘Top Threats to Cloud Computing: Deep Dive’ provides technical details dealing with architecture, compliance, risk and mitigations for each of the cloud computing threats and vulnerabilities identified in a previous CSA survey.
Top Threats to Cloud Computing: Deep Dive takes a case study approach to ‘connect all the dots when it comes to risk management’.
The paper goes on to outline recommended Cloud Controls Matrix (CCM) domains, sorted according to how often controls within the domains are relevant as a mitigating control.
